New Pathways in Lenoir City, TN provides substance use disorder treatment services to individuals seeking recovery. The facility offers outpatient programming designed to address addiction challenges through evidence-based approaches. While comprehensive information about the facility setting and specific credentials is limited in public records, New Pathways maintains a presence in the addiction treatment landscape of eastern Tennessee.

About This Outpatient Recovery Center

New Pathways operates as an outpatient substance use disorder treatment provider, allowing clients to receive care while maintaining their daily responsibilities. The program structure appears to focus on accessibility, enabling participants to integrate recovery work into their existing schedules rather than requiring residential commitment. Information about specific accreditations and licensing is not readily available in public resources.

Treatment Programs and Methods

The treatment programming at New Pathways centers on outpatient services tailored to address substance use disorders through structured interventions.

  • Individual counseling sessions focusing on addiction-specific challenges
  • Group therapy providing peer support and shared learning experiences
  • Substance use education and relapse prevention strategies
  • Recovery skills development and practical coping mechanisms
  • Outpatient treatment scheduling that accommodates work and family commitments
